mirror of
				https://github.com/Jokiller230/puzzlevision.git
				synced 2025-10-31 05:40:05 +00:00 
			
		
		
		
	Compare commits
	
		
			2 commits
		
	
	
		
			8edd189f07
			...
			1eea028fec
		
	
	| Author | SHA1 | Date | |
|---|---|---|---|
| 1eea028fec | |||
| c38ecb55a2 | 
					 8 changed files with 40 additions and 72 deletions
				
			
		
							
								
								
									
										50
									
								
								flake.lock
									
										
									
										generated
									
									
									
								
							
							
						
						
									
										50
									
								
								flake.lock
									
										
									
										generated
									
									
									
								
							|  | @ -7,11 +7,11 @@ | |||
|         ] | ||||
|       }, | ||||
|       "locked": { | ||||
|         "lastModified": 1756741629, | ||||
|         "narHash": "sha256-n+mgH3NoQf8d1jd8cDp/9Mt++hhyuE3LO3ZAxzjWRZw=", | ||||
|         "lastModified": 1758186094, | ||||
|         "narHash": "sha256-uvfqk4A5pCKwGvq0f/ZrmqarF80KViSNfYWKdeOYFaw=", | ||||
|         "owner": "catppuccin", | ||||
|         "repo": "nix", | ||||
|         "rev": "cd22197da06df1eb6fabdaa2fc22c170c4f67382", | ||||
|         "rev": "ff94d16ca2d7f51b9fc4a7f6559dc18de54d1915",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-94,11 +94,11 @@ | |||
|         ] | ||||
|       }, | ||||
|       "locked": { | ||||
|         "lastModified": 1756842514, | ||||
|         "narHash": "sha256-XbtRMewPGJwTNhBC4pnBu3w/xT1XejvB0HfohC2Kga8=", | ||||
|         "lastModified": 1758207369, | ||||
|         "narHash": "sha256-BG7GlXo5moXtrFSCqnkIb1Q00szOZXTj5Dx7NmWgves=", | ||||
|         "owner": "nix-community", | ||||
|         "repo": "home-manager", | ||||
|         "rev": "30fc1b532645a21e157b6e33e3f8b4c154f86382", | ||||
|         "rev": "b5698ed57db7ee7da5e93df2e6bbada91c88f3ce",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-138,11 +138,11 @@ | |||
|         ] | ||||
|       }, | ||||
|       "locked": { | ||||
|         "lastModified": 1756516619, | ||||
|         "narHash": "sha256-iWNyhVIBO/CxQdLeQAfedynD68+SmIq5lj/TJpJyUSA=", | ||||
|         "lastModified": 1758183841, | ||||
|         "narHash": "sha256-c04iKVUNTZDYlWIcToS9/jLgqA5BgkxTYE0Opn0Hxpw=", | ||||
|         "owner": "kaylorben", | ||||
|         "repo": "nixcord", | ||||
|         "rev": "eed47b8dc6601e94f0b4ce71bfea349869b541c0", | ||||
|         "rev": "1be1e2031b70966b8ae5ec86ada23d8a05e81d73",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-153,11 +153,11 @@ | |||
|     }, | ||||
|     "nixos-hardware": { | ||||
|       "locked": { | ||||
|         "lastModified": 1756750488, | ||||
|         "narHash": "sha256-e4ZAu2sjOtGpvbdS5zo+Va5FUUkAnizl4wb0/JlIL2I=", | ||||
|         "lastModified": 1757943327, | ||||
|         "narHash": "sha256-w6cDExPBqbq7fTLo4dZ1ozDGeq3yV6dSN4n/sAaS6OM=", | ||||
|         "owner": "NixOS", | ||||
|         "repo": "nixos-hardware", | ||||
|         "rev": "47eb4856cfd01eaeaa7bb5944a0f27db8fb9b94a", | ||||
|         "rev": "67a709cfe5d0643dafd798b0b613ed579de8be05",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-168,11 +168,11 @@ | |||
|     }, | ||||
|     "nixpkgs": { | ||||
|       "locked": { | ||||
|         "lastModified": 1756542300, | ||||
|         "narHash": "sha256-tlOn88coG5fzdyqz6R93SQL5Gpq+m/DsWpekNFhqPQk=", | ||||
|         "lastModified": 1758035966, | ||||
|         "narHash": "sha256-qqIJ3yxPiB0ZQTT9//nFGQYn8X/PBoJbofA7hRKZnmE=", | ||||
|         "owner": "NixOS", | ||||
|         "repo": "nixpkgs", | ||||
|         "rev": "d7600c775f877cd87b4f5a831c28aa94137377aa", | ||||
|         "rev": "8d4ddb19d03c65a36ad8d189d001dc32ffb0306b",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-203,11 +203,11 @@ | |||
|         ] | ||||
|       }, | ||||
|       "locked": { | ||||
|         "lastModified": 1754988908, | ||||
|         "narHash": "sha256-t+voe2961vCgrzPFtZxha0/kmFSHFobzF00sT8p9h0U=", | ||||
|         "lastModified": 1758007585, | ||||
|         "narHash": "sha256-HYnwlbY6RE5xVd5rh0bYw77pnD8lOgbT4mlrfjgNZ0c=", | ||||
|         "owner": "Mic92", | ||||
|         "repo": "sops-nix", | ||||
|         "rev": "3223c7a92724b5d804e9988c6b447a0d09017d48", | ||||
|         "rev": "f77d4cfa075c3de66fc9976b80e0c4fc69e2c139",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|  | @ -239,16 +239,16 @@ | |||
|         ] | ||||
|       }, | ||||
|       "locked": { | ||||
|         "lastModified": 1756547894, | ||||
|         "narHash": "sha256-iu0pzPv3ArB8m9H4rH7bFMjRspA5thRV6kp9fVLagZc=", | ||||
|         "owner": "tomromeo", | ||||
|         "repo": "vicinae-nix", | ||||
|         "rev": "5eea3c1f5d10abc074b27c65a38b1ca3b9a8adeb", | ||||
|         "lastModified": 1758213608, | ||||
|         "narHash": "sha256-/CPyP3EC9EMYuGWrzPRpnWRrmw01N7upfB+xIRxfLUU=", | ||||
|         "owner": "vicinaehq", | ||||
|         "repo": "vicinae", | ||||
|         "rev": "a026db18b9f9a29edd94305b4e77d196bf91afb0", | ||||
|         "type": "github" | ||||
|       }, | ||||
|       "original": { | ||||
|         "owner": "tomromeo", | ||||
|         "repo": "vicinae-nix", | ||||
|         "owner": "vicinaehq", | ||||
|         "repo": "vicinae", | ||||
|         "type": "github" | ||||
|       } | ||||
|     } | ||||
|  |  | |||
|  | @ -55,7 +55,7 @@ | |||
|     }; | ||||
| 
 | ||||
|     vicinae = { | ||||
|       url = "github:tomromeo/vicinae-nix"; | ||||
|       url = "github:vicinaehq/vicinae"; | ||||
|       inputs.nixpkgs.follows = "nixpkgs"; | ||||
|     }; | ||||
|   }; | ||||
|  |  | |||
|  | @ -1,9 +1,14 @@ | |||
| { | ||||
|   pkgs, | ||||
|   ... | ||||
| }: | ||||
| { | ||||
|   puzzlevision.apps.packettracer = { | ||||
|     enable = true; | ||||
|     binaryPath = ./Packet_Tracer822_amd64_signed.deb; | ||||
|   }; | ||||
|   home.packages = | ||||
|     with pkgs; | ||||
|     if builtins.pathExists ./Packet_Tracer822_amd64_signed.deb then | ||||
|       [ | ||||
|         (ciscoPacketTracer8.override { packetTracerSource = ./Packet_Tracer822_amd64_signed.deb; }) | ||||
|       ] | ||||
|     else | ||||
|       [ ]; | ||||
| } | ||||
|  |  | |||
|  | @ -1,28 +0,0 @@ | |||
| { | ||||
|   config, | ||||
|   self, | ||||
|   pkgs, | ||||
|   lib, | ||||
|   ... | ||||
| }: | ||||
| let | ||||
|   inherit (self) namespace; | ||||
|   inherit (self.lib) mkOpt; | ||||
|   inherit (lib) mkEnableOption types mkIf; | ||||
| 
 | ||||
|   cfg = config.${namespace}.apps.packettracer; | ||||
| in | ||||
| { | ||||
|   options.${namespace}.apps.packettracer = { | ||||
|     enable = mkEnableOption "the Cisco Packettracer application, a network emulator."; | ||||
|     binaryPath = | ||||
|       mkOpt types.path null | ||||
|         "The path of the Packettracer binary. Has to be downloaded from Cisco Netacad"; | ||||
|   }; | ||||
| 
 | ||||
|   config = mkIf cfg.enable { | ||||
|     home.packages = with pkgs; [ | ||||
|       (ciscoPacketTracer8.override { packetTracerSource = cfg.binaryPath; }) | ||||
|     ]; | ||||
|   }; | ||||
| } | ||||
|  | @ -41,18 +41,9 @@ in | |||
|         ### Remove useless features and stuff | ||||
|         show_call_status_icon = false; | ||||
|         collaboration_panel.button = false; | ||||
|         chat_panel.button = "never"; | ||||
| 
 | ||||
|         agent = { | ||||
|           version = "2"; | ||||
|           button = false; | ||||
|         }; | ||||
| 
 | ||||
|         features = { | ||||
|           inline_completion_provider = "none"; | ||||
|           edit_prediction_provider = "none"; | ||||
|           copilot = false; | ||||
|         }; | ||||
|         ### Disable AI features entirely | ||||
|         disable_ai = true; | ||||
| 
 | ||||
|         ### Formatting and saving settings | ||||
|         formatter = "language_server"; | ||||
|  | @ -92,7 +83,6 @@ in | |||
|           # Web dev | ||||
|           html = true; | ||||
|           svelte = true; | ||||
|           ejs = true; | ||||
|           scss = true; | ||||
|           biome = true; # Formatting and utility tool, like ESlint, prettier, etc... | ||||
| 
 | ||||
|  |  | |||
|  | @ -65,7 +65,7 @@ in | |||
|       }; | ||||
|     }; | ||||
|     wallpaper = | ||||
|       mkOpt path ../wallpapers/building_top_sit_dusk.jpg | ||||
|       mkOpt path ../wallpapers/scenic-landscape-blurred.jpg | ||||
|         "Specify the path of your prefered Gnome wallpaper."; | ||||
|   }; | ||||
| 
 | ||||
|  |  | |||
							
								
								
									
										
											BIN
										
									
								
								modules/home/desktop/wallpapers/scenic-landscape-blurred.jpg
									
										
									
									
									
										Normal file
									
								
							
							
						
						
									
										
											BIN
										
									
								
								modules/home/desktop/wallpapers/scenic-landscape-blurred.jpg
									
										
									
									
									
										Normal file
									
								
							
										
											Binary file not shown.
										
									
								
							| After Width: | Height: | Size: 1.3 MiB | 
|  | @ -20,6 +20,7 @@ in | |||
|     services.displayManager.gdm.enable = true; | ||||
|     services.desktopManager.gnome.enable = true; | ||||
| 
 | ||||
|     # Exclude various Gnome core applications | ||||
|     environment.gnome.excludePackages = with pkgs; [ | ||||
|       gnome-tour | ||||
|       gedit | ||||
|  | @ -43,7 +44,7 @@ in | |||
|     environment.systemPackages = with pkgs; [ | ||||
|       refine | ||||
|       showtime | ||||
|       resources | ||||
|       mission-center | ||||
|     ]; | ||||
|   }; | ||||
| } | ||||
|  |  | |||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ue